Gases: You analyze that principal components of a gas inside a valve. Through spectroscopy, you were able to analyze that components of the gas mixture are 02, N2 and H2 respectively. From that you would like to check if you have learned something from GCHEM203A by determining (a) what are the mole fractions of each component in the mixture of 15.08 g of O2, 8.17 g of N2, and 2.64 g of H2? (b) What is the partial pressure in atm of each component of this mixture if it is held in a 15.50-L vessel at 15 °C?
